What Makes a Mattress High-Quality Yet Affordable?
Several factors contribute to finding the best quality affordable mattress:
- Material Quality: The type of materials used in a mattress significantly affects its durability and comfort. High-quality foam, latex, or innerspring coils can provide excellent support and longevity, while still being cost-effective when sourced from reputable manufacturers.
- Construction and Design: A well-constructed mattress with proper layering can enhance comfort and support. Features such as zoning, where different areas of the mattress offer varying levels of firmness, can improve sleep quality without substantially increasing the price.
- Brand Reputation: Established brands often offer better warranties and customer service, which can influence the overall value of the mattress. Choosing a brand known for quality but that also provides affordable options can lead to a worthwhile investment.
- Trial Period and Warranty: A mattress that comes with a generous trial period allows consumers to test comfort levels without risk. A solid warranty can also indicate confidence in product quality and provide peace of mind regarding durability.
- Sales and Discounts: Timing your purchase during sales events or promotional periods can significantly reduce costs without sacrificing quality. Many brands offer seasonal sales, which can be an excellent opportunity to find a high-quality mattress at a more affordable price.
- Customer Reviews: Researching customer feedback can provide insights into the mattress’s performance and comfort over time. High ratings from customers who highlight durability and satisfaction are usually indicative of a good quality product at a reasonable price.

What Features Should You Prioritize in a Budget Mattress?
When searching for the best quality affordable mattress, several key features should be prioritized to ensure comfort and durability.
- Material: The type of material used in the mattress greatly affects its comfort and longevity. Memory foam offers excellent contouring and pressure relief, while innerspring mattresses provide better support and airflow. Hybrid mattresses combine both types, giving a balanced feel.
- Firmness Level: Firmness is subjective and varies based on personal preference and sleeping position. Generally, side sleepers benefit from a softer mattress for cushioning hips and shoulders, while back and stomach sleepers may require a firmer surface for spinal alignment.
- Durability: A budget mattress should still offer durability to withstand regular use. Look for warranties and reviews to assess longevity, as cheaper materials may wear out faster, leading to discomfort over time.
- Motion Isolation: If you share your bed, motion isolation is an important feature to consider. Memory foam mattresses typically excel in this area, preventing disturbances when one person moves, which is beneficial for undisturbed sleep.
- Temperature Regulation: Sleeping hot can be an issue with some mattress types, especially memory foam. Look for features like breathable covers, gel-infused foam, or innerspring designs that allow for better airflow and temperature control.
- Size Options: Ensure the mattress comes in the appropriate size for your needs, whether it’s twin, full, queen, or king. A budget mattress should not compromise on size options, as this can affect comfort and fit in your sleeping area.
- Trial Period and Return Policy: A good trial period allows you to test the mattress at home to ensure it meets your comfort needs. A flexible return policy can provide peace of mind, especially when investing in a budget mattress, ensuring you can exchange it if it doesn’t suit you.

How Can You Determine the Right Firmness for an Affordable Mattress?
Choosing the right firmness for an affordable mattress involves understanding personal preferences, sleeping positions, and body types.
- Personal Comfort Level: It’s crucial to assess your own comfort preferences when selecting mattress firmness. Some people prefer a softer feel that allows them to sink in, while others may favor a firmer surface that provides more support.
- Sleeping Position: Your primary sleeping position significantly influences the ideal firmness level. Side sleepers typically benefit from a softer mattress that cushions the shoulders and hips, while back and stomach sleepers often require a firmer mattress to maintain spinal alignment.
- Body Weight: A person’s weight can affect how a mattress feels and performs. Lighter individuals may find that softer mattresses provide adequate support and comfort, whereas heavier individuals often need firmer options to prevent excessive sinking and ensure proper spinal support.
- Material Considerations: The materials used in the mattress can also impact firmness perception. Memory foam tends to provide a softer feel due to its contouring nature, while innerspring or hybrid mattresses may offer a firmer surface with better support and bounce.
- Trial Periods and Returns: Many affordable mattress brands offer trial periods, allowing you to test the firmness at home. Take advantage of these trials to determine what feels best for you, and ensure the return policy is flexible if the firmness is not right.
What Common Materials Are Found in Quality Affordable Mattresses?
Quality affordable mattresses often feature a combination of materials that balance comfort, support, and cost-effectiveness.
- Memory Foam: This material adapts to the body’s shape, providing personalized support and pressure relief. Quality affordable mattresses typically use a high-density memory foam that retains its shape over time and offers a good balance of softness and support.
- Innerspring Coils: Innerspring mattresses use metal coils to provide support and bounce. Affordable options may feature a pocketed coil system that minimizes motion transfer, making them a good choice for couples who share a bed.
- Latex: Natural or synthetic latex is known for its durability and responsiveness. Affordable latex mattresses can provide a buoyant feel, which helps in maintaining proper spinal alignment while being resistant to dust mites and mold.
- Polyfoam: Polyurethane foam is often used in layers to provide cushioning and support, and is typically more cost-effective than memory foam. It can be used in combination with other materials to enhance comfort without significantly raising the price.
- Gel Infusions: Many quality affordable mattresses incorporate gel-infused foam to help regulate temperature and provide cooling properties. This feature is particularly beneficial for those who tend to sleep hot, as it helps dissipate heat away from the body.
- Hybrid Construction: Hybrid mattresses combine various materials, such as memory foam and innerspring coils, to offer the benefits of both. This construction type allows for a balanced comfort level, providing both support and pressure relief at an affordable price point.
